Dietician Courtney Kassis recently took to Instagram on December 2 to break down how to spot fake fibres, and which real, fibre-rich foods you should be prioritising instead. "Fake fibre is the stuff that's added to processed foods to make the nutrition label look good. But, it does nothing for fullness, cravings, hormones, or fat loss because your body doesn't treat it like real fibre. Instead, it acts like a quick acting carb with little to no benefit on the body," says Courtney, calling these the "worst offenders". According to Courtney, most of the fibre in modern diets comes from these fake sources, explaining why so many people continue to feel unsatisfied, bloated, and stuck. If you want to identify fake fibre, Courtney says the key is to look beyond the nutrition label and focus on the ingredients list instead. She notes, "If it says anything like chicory root fibre, soluble corn fibre, tapioca fibre, or inulin, these are isolated fibres added for marketing purposes, not health purposes." According to the dietician, real fibre comes from, quite simply, real food. The highest concentrations are found in berries such as raspberries and blackberries, avocados, chia and flax seeds, oats, and vegetables. While aiming for 30 grams of fibre a day is important, Courtney stresses that it only counts when it comes from the right sources and is built into your diet with proper structure. As Courtney explains, "Getting at least 30 grams of fibre daily from real food helps to stabilise blood sugar, keeps you full, supports your hormones, reduces inflammation, and even helps you burn fat."...
